"Those small rooms are closed to an area of water, it looks like a river."

This is called a 'run-on' sentence. Here, you have 2 independent clauses that are connected with only a comma. This is not possible. You need to use a coordinating conjunction or transition.

"we can say that it shows the effects of the bad weather, poor area, and how people try hardly to get their food."

Here, you have a problem with parallel structure. Whenever you have a list of 2 or more things, you need to use the same grammar structure. For example, you can't say "I like runnning, swimming, and to ski" because you have 2 gerunds and an infinitive. All of the thinggs need to be gerunds or infinitives. Of course, you may use any grammatical structure as long as they are all the same.
